A 22 crossover might be a bit small but OK to try. You could probably steal the 28 or 26 out of the main stack without it causing too much influence overall as well.
With the bleed stack just invert everything below the spacer. IE 16x0.1 14x0.3 14x0.3 CLAMP 20x1.6 SPACER Inverted stack 22x0.1x4 20x0.1 18x0.1 16x0.1 14x0.1 11x0.3 11x0.3 bleed ports around post. This will take the whole bleed stack out of the equation. The 2 11x0.3mm shims won't restrict the bleed at all. The rest of the inverted stack just maintains some height for the stack on the post. |
